2. Industry Compliance and Quality Assurance

Compliance with the European Community is a binary requirement: products either have the CE marking or they cannot be sold in the EU/EEA. The process involves a rigorous six-step framework involving risk assessment, standard identification, testing, and technical file compilation.

  • Certification Requirements: Mandatory certificates are required for specific categories including toys (EN 71), electronics (LVD/EMC), and Food Contact Materials (FCM).
  • Conformity Assessment: The process typically involves a "self-declaration" for low-risk products but requires a "Notified Body" intervention for high-risk categories (e.g., medical devices, pressure equipment).
  • Documentation Standards: A Technical File must be maintained for 10 years post-production, containing design drawings, risk assessments, and test reports.
  • Cost of Standards: Accessing harmonized standards required for compliance can cost up to €1,500 per standard document, which must be factored into the compliance budget.

Actionable Recommendation: Verify that the supplier has already obtained the CE marking certificate for the specific product model. Request the Declaration of Conformity (DoC) and the full Technical File. Ensure the supplier's quality management system (ISO 9001) is aligned with EU inspection protocols to avoid customs seizures.

4. Typical Use Cases

The "European Community" framework applies to a vast array of sectors. Procurement decisions should align with the specific directive governing the product category.

  • Consumer Electronics: Smartphones, power banks, and home appliances requiring LVD and EMC compliance for safe operation in EU households.
  • Toys & Children's Products: Educational toys, plastic figures, and baby gear requiring strict EN 71 safety testing for mechanical, flammability, and chemical hazards.
  • Food Contact Materials (FCM): Packaging, kitchenware, and storage containers requiring migration testing to ensure no harmful substances leach into food.
  • Industrial Machinery: Manufacturing equipment requiring the Machinery Directive (2006/42/EC) to ensure operator safety and emergency stop functionality.
  • Medical Devices: Diagnostic tools and surgical instruments requiring MDR (Medical Device Regulation) compliance and CE marking via a Notified Body.

Actionable Recommendation: Map your procurement needs to the specific EU Directives applicable to your product. If purchasing generic "industrial goods," explicitly ask the supplier which Directive (e.g., Machinery, Pressure Equipment, PPE) applies to ensure the correct compliance path is taken.

7. Frequently Asked Questions (FAQ)

Q1: What is the difference between CE marking and a generic quality certificate? A: CE marking is a mandatory legal requirement for specific products to enter the EU/EEA market, indicating conformity with health, safety, and environmental protection standards. A generic quality certificate is voluntary and does not grant market access.

Q2: How long does the CE certification process typically take? A: The timeline varies by product complexity. For low-risk products (self-declaration), it can take 2–4 weeks. For high-risk products requiring a Notified Body, the process typically takes 8–12 weeks due to testing and audit requirements.

Q3: Can I sell CE-marked products in the UK after Brexit? A: Generally, CE marking is still accepted in Great Britain for most products, but the UK has introduced its own UKCA marking. Procurement teams should verify if the supplier holds both CE and UKCA marks if targeting the UK market specifically.

Q4: What happens if a product fails CE compliance during a market surveillance check? A: The product can be recalled, destroyed, or fined. The supplier may be banned from selling in the EU, and the importer (you) can face significant liability and reputational damage.

Q5: Do I need to pay for the harmonized standards documents? A: Yes, accessing the specific EN standards required for compliance can cost up to €1,500 per document. This cost is often passed on to the buyer or factored into the product price.

Q6: Is the CE mark valid for all EU countries? A: Yes, the CE mark is valid across all EU Member States and the European Economic Area (EEA), allowing free movement of goods without additional national testing.

Q7: What is the "Six Steps" to CE marking? A: The six steps generally involve: 1) Identify applicable directives, 2) Identify harmonized standards, 3) Verify product conformity (testing), 4) Compile technical documentation, 5) Sign the Declaration of Conformity, and 6) Affix the CE mark.

Q8: How long must the Technical File be kept? A: The Technical File and Declaration of Conformity must be retained by the manufacturer or authorized representative for 10 years after the last product is placed on the market.
